Output 75b739acd80895c40d26d0ef71a008a67ac6c434cedd2537bb35d6b390baa4e7:1

value
1000652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26108275710e6ade1108bac1d4d61ea700167c13 OP_EQUAL
address
35AHNwWufF3h9SzdBBvZttQqaZtdjpLxe4
transaction
75b739acd80895c40d26d0ef71a008a67ac6c434cedd2537bb35d6b390baa4e7
spent
true